Questions & Answers also had a profound impact on the presidential election of 1990 after Brian Lenihan denied that he had tried to influence President Paddy Hillery in relation to the dissolution of the Dáil in 1982. This set in train a series of events that led to the election of Mary Robinson.
There were also memorable cross-party contributions from Pat Cox in relation to the Phoenix Park affair involving Emmet Stagg, and Charlie McCreevy’s defence of the Fine Gael politician arrested outside a brothel.
